HBC255044念数字小红的环形数组题解

人生如戏 算法基础篇 19 0
全网最全C++题库,助您快速提升编程技能!题库丰富多样,涵盖各个领域,让您在练习中不断成长!
小红拿到了一个环形数组,她定义两个下标的贡献f(i,j)=dis(i,j)f(i,j)=*dis(i,j)f(i,j)=dis(i,j),其中dis(i,j)dis(i,j)dis(i,j)为下标iii和下标jjj在数组中的距离,小红想知道,每一对下标的贡献之和是多少?用数学语言描述,你需要求出∑i=1n∑j=i+1nf(i,j)sum_{i=1}^nsum_{j=i+1}^n f(i,j)∑i=1n∑j=i+1nf(i,j)的值,并对答案取模109+710^9+7109+7。

小红拿到了一个环形数组。她定义两个下标的贡献f(i,j)=(ai+aj)∗dis(i,j)f(i,j)=(a_i+a_j)*dis(i,j)f(i,j)=(ai​+aj​)∗dis(i,j),其中dis(i,j)dis(i,j)dis(i,j)为下标iii和下标jjj在数组中的距离。小红想知道,每一对下标的贡献之和是多少? 用数学语言描述,你需要求出∑i=1n∑j=i+1nf(i,j)sum_{i=1}^nsum_{j=i+1}^n f(i,j)∑i=1n​∑j=i+1n​f(i,j)的值,并对答案取模109+710^9+7109+7。

HBC255044念数字小红的环形数组题解
-第1张图片-东莞河马信息技术
(图片来源网络,侵删)
全网最全C++题库,助您挑战自我,突破极限,成为编程领域的佼佼者!

标签: HBC255044念数字小红的环形数组题解